  • Passionate about local commerce. Creativity and innovation The pandemic has taught us the importance of loving what is ours. Whether due to lack of supplies or mobility restrictions, we all appreciate a little more the potatoes from Sa Pobla, the oranges from Soller… It is only fair to add the economic effort of these small producers who are passionate about their products and give us a little bit of tradition in each of their experiences. Buy local produce, the local economy and the sustainability of the planet will thank you.
